The annual salary statistics of all other physicians in Boston-Cambridge-Quincy, Massachusetts is shown in Table 1. The wage data of all other physicians in Boston-Cambridge-Quincy is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
|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
|---|---|
| 10th Percentile Wage | $68,050 |
| 25th Percentile Wage | $81,290 |
| 50th Percentile Wage | $223,410 |
| 75th Percentile Wage | No Data |
| 90th Percentile Wage | No Data |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for all other physicians in Boston-Cambridge-Quincy, Massachusetts in 5 percentile scales.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$223,410. The average annual salary of the 25th percentile is $81,290.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$68,050.
